F1 Fan Claims Taylor Swift Would Have Preferred Dating Daniel Ricciardo Over Fernando Alonso

F1 fans around the world have been buzzing ever since rumors spread that two-time world champion Fernando Alonso could potentially be dating American pop star, Taylor Swift. The rumors of the two dating each other first emerged on Duexmoi, an anonymous gossip page on Instagram.

Since then, some Spanish websites have also reported that the two have been seeing each other for a week. While there is no certainty over these rumors, they have spread like fire all across social media.

What made these rumors gather even more steam is that Alonso himself responded to them. Even though many fans have been buzzing over these links, there is one fan who believes that Swift would have preferred to date Daniel Ricciardo over the Spanish driver.

Fernando Alonso teased fans with multiple posts on social media

Fernando Alonso seems to be enjoying the attention he is receiving on social media recently as he has teased his fans by directly addressing the dating rumors. Earlier in the day on April 24, the Spaniard put up two different posts about Taylor Swift.

In his first post, he put up Swift’s famous Karma song on his Tiktok account and ended the video with a wink. Soon after, he put up another post, where he said that he was ‘feeling 33’. While his second post is cryptic, the link that it has to Swift is that she is 33 years old.

Alonso previously dated F1 reporter Schagler

Before these rumors emerged of Fernando Alonso potentially dating Taylor Swift, the Spaniard previously was in a relationship with F1 reporter Andrea Schagler. The two dated each other for over a year before splitting up earlier this year.

Alonso and Schagler informed their fans about the same via an emotional Instagram post. Their post read, “We wanted to tell you that our relationship as a couple has ended. We have been lucky enough to have spent a fantastic time together, and it will continue to be so, but on a different form of affection”.
